Prominent WNBA head coach James Wade leaving mid-season for NBA assistant job

A prominent WNBA head coach has decided to accept another job. James Wade, who works as the general manager and head coach of the Chicago Sky, is leaving the team to accept an NBA position with the Toronto Raptors.

James Kay of the Skyhook Pod reported the news of the change on Saturday. Wade had been the head coach of the Sky since 2019.

It’s an interesting move for Wade, as the NBA season won’t begin until October. He could’ve finished out the WNBA season before stepping down from his current role. Then again, the Raptors may have wanted a strong commitment from the start.

Breaking per release: James Wade has been hired by the Toronto Raptors as an assistant coach and he will be stepping down as General Manager and Head Coach of the Chicago Sky. Emre Vatansever, Chicago’s top assistant, has been named Interim General Manager and Head Coach.

Per the report, Chicago assistant Emre Vatansever will become the head coach and general manager on an interim basis. There are 24 games remaining on the Sky’s schedule in 2023.

The Raptors are undergoing change, moving on from Nick Nurse from the 2022-23 season and hiring Darko Rajakovic, who most recently spent three seasons as an assistant with the Memphis Grizzlies.

This will be Wade’s first job in the NBA. He’s been the head coach of the Sky since 2019, totaling an 81-59 mark, which includes a 7-9 record in 2023.

Chicago has reached the playoffs in each of the previous four seasons with Wade at the helm. The team won the WNBA Finals in 2021. Prior to taking the head coaching gig in Chicago, Wade worked as an assistant with the San Antonio Stars (2012-16) and Minnesota Lynx (2017-18).

Toronto hoping to return as NBA contender

The Raptors took home the NBA’s top prize in 2019, winning the championship over the Golden State Warriors. In the four seasons since, it’s been a bit of a roller coaster for the franchise.

Toronto reached the playoffs only twice over the last four seasons with just one series victory. This past season, the Raptors posted a 41-41 record and missed the playoff picture for the second time in three seasons.

At the end of the year, the organization opted to make a head coaching change. Will the transition from Nurse to Rajakovic help get the Raptors back near the top of the Eastern Conference?
